Readability and Real-World Testing

No matter how beautiful a font looks in a preview window, you have to test it in your actual materials. Print a label at the smallest size you plan to use and hold it at arm’s length. Can you still read the ingredients? Place a menu mockup on your phone screen and ask a friend to find the price of an item. Those tests will tell you whether the typography is serving your customer or just decorating your product. The sans serif in Fujinstall Font Duo holds up well at smaller sizes because its letterforms are clean and open. The script is best reserved for larger applications where its flourishes have room to breathe.

For social media, create a test post in your design app and zoom out to thumbnail size. If the script becomes a blurry squiggle, use it only on the first slide and rely on the sans serif for the rest. This kind of practical checking ensures your professional look survives the noisy online environment.

Commercial Licensing and Your Business

Before you use any font on products you sell, packaging you distribute, or client work you deliver, you need to check the commercial license. Not all fonts allow you to use them on merchandise, templates, or digital products you sell. Fujinstall Font Duo may be available with a standard desktop license for personal and small business use, but if you plan to create thousands of units, sell digital downloads, or offer design services to paying clients, you may need an extended license. Always read the terms on the site where you purchase or download the font. Paying a little more for the right license protects you from legal headaches and supports the designer who made the font.
